Document Control Manager/Sr. Specialist at Mission Barns, you will report to the Director of Quality and help lead the company’s document management and Quality compliance record keeping. You will play a crucial role in defining, executing, and improving the organization’s document management strategy. You will work closely across all aspects of laboratory work, process, and personnel to ensure excellence and compliance.
Responsibilities
  • Lead day-to-day Document Control activities including processing Document Change Orders (DCO) and Change Requests (CR); creating, revising, review, tracking and releasing Standard Operating Procedures (SOP), Batch Production Records (BPRs), Work Instructions (WI), and other controlled documents in a timely manner while ensuring compliance with all Quality, Regulatory (21 CRF Part 11) and company standards.
  • Serve as point-person/system admin for the company's electronic Document Management Systems (eDMS).
  • Collaborate with cross-functional departments to ensure timely implementation of changes to controlled documents.
  • Print, compile and issue all lot related documentation (batch records, forms, labels, sample plans, specifications, etc.).
  • Manage paper and electronic documentation storage and retrieval processes and systems for archiving and retention of controlled documents.
  • Provide support to company wide users and training of new hires and partners in Document Control processes. 
  • Track KPIs/metrics and report progress during Quality management reviews.
  • Assist with incident investigations against lot/batch documentation and records issuance system.
  • Support internal and external audits and inspections with documentation preparation and addressing pertinent observations/findings, as applicable.
